ESCAPE ROOMS FOR INTERPROFESSIONAL EDUCATION  

January 29, 2024 |10:00 am UTC | 3:00 pm ET | 12:00 pm PT

IPSS Member: Free | Non-Member: $50

Escape rooms are fun activities that can engage learners, encourage problem-solving skills, and promote teamwork behaviors. Escape rooms can be created using a variety of common tools and equipment and can be incorporated in a variety of settings. 

The objectives of this webinar are to:

1) Describe how escape groups incorporate educational pedagogy

2) Allow participants to experience an escape room activity and debriefing

3) Demonstrate examples of how participants can create an escape room for their own learners.

Meet the Speakers: 


Erin Carn-Bennett (ADHB) 

Erin is a Simulation Nurse Educator with the Douglas Starship Simulation Programme in Auckland, New Zealand. She has a background in Pediatric Emergency Nursing and Nursing Management. Erin is also a Critical Incident Debriefer and Professional Supervisor for Nurses. She is the lead host of the podcast "SimNurseNZ" and a freelance writer for HealthySimulation.com. Erin is on the Board of Directors for IPSS.

Alison Cartwright (ADHB) 

Alison Cartwright is a Nurse Educator with the Douglas Starship Simulation Programme, and an Academic Nursing Lecturer at Manukau Institute of Technology in Auckland, New Zealand. She completed her RN training specializing in pediatric nursing at the world-renowned Great Ormond Street Hospital for Children, UK in 2000, and worked in a variety of clinical settings before settling in pediatric emergency nursing for the past 18 years. It was here that Alison was introduced to simulation training, and a passion for education. Alison is an active member of both IPSS and NZASH, presenting at conference in 2023, and 2022 respectively, with a particular interest in the transformational education possibilities through the application of augmented and virtual reality technology. As an APLS NZ instructor she enjoys further opportunities to meet with and instruct other health professionals committed to delivering exemplary pediatric emergency care.

          

Traci Wolbrink MD, MPH 

Traci Wolbrink, MD, MPH, is a pediatric intensivist at Boston Children’s Hospital and Associate Professor of Anesthesia at Harvard Medical School. Her academic interests include developing and studying innovative online educational strategies. She is Co-Director of OPEN Pediatrics an open access online learning program for healthcare professionals, and Co-Director of the Boston Children’s Hospital Center for Educational Excellence and Innovation. She serves as a Course Director for the Harvard Macy Institute Transforming your Teaching Using Technology Course.
